Tribune Site on the North Branch Approved today -Phase 1A -$305M first phase build out -1500 residential units -4 buildings: 508', 307', 154', & 124' -497 parking spaces -70'-80' setback from the river -100' distance between towers -Underfeeder park -Overall buildout of 30 acres is a $2,500,000,000 -All affordable housing on site -10 year project Image Unavailable, Please Login Image Unavailable, Please Login Image Unavailable, Please Login Image Unavailable, Please Login Image Unavailable, Please Login Image Unavailable, Please Login
